What Is a Live Casino Online?

live casino online

Live casino online is a unique type of real money gambling that involves playing table games such as blackjack and roulette with a live dealer. These games are streamed to players’ computers in real time using high-definition video cameras, and the results are then transmitted back to the player. This type of gaming offers a more authentic experience than traditional online casinos. The games are often broadcast from dedicated studios that are overseen by a qualified dealer. This makes the games as fair as possible, and the casino will also provide information about rules and payout rates to players.

The dealers at a live casino online will use RFID sensors to track each bet as it is placed. The information is then sent to a database, and the results are then compared to the bets that were made by players. If the results match, the system will automatically issue a payout to the player. This process is quick and secure, and it gives players a more realistic feel to the game.

The most popular live casino online games are the ones that feature a real dealer and can be played on most devices. These games can include the classics such as blackjack, roulette and baccarat as well as newer titles like Dream Catcher and Lightning Roulette.
